van Basten’s Young Guns
I was considering van Basten’s comments a while back about how he was looking forward to Euro 2008 and not specifically this year’s world cup. I thought we would have a look at the players named in the squad and see where they’ll be come 2008 and 2010.
Goalkeeper: Average age = 33.5
Patrick Lodewijks -39, Edwin van der Sar -36,
Maarten Stekelenburg -24, Henk Timmer -35
Defenders: Average age = 26.8
Khalid Boulahrouz -25, Wilfred Bouma -28,
Giovanni van Bronckhorst -31, Tim de Cler -28,
Urby Emanuelson -20, Kew Jaliens -28,
Jan Kromkamp -26 , Joris Mathijsen -26,
Andre Ooijer -32 , Barry Opdam -30,
Ron Vlaar -21
Midfielders: Average age = 27.4
George Boateng -31, Phillip Cocu -36,
Edgar Davids -33,
Nigel De Jong -22, Denny Landzaat , -30,
Hedwiges Maduro -21, Wesley Sneijder -22,
Rafael van der Vaart -23 , Mark van Bommel -29
Forwards: Average age = 25
Ryan Babel -20, Romeo Castelen -23,
Klaas-Jan Huntelaar -23, Dirk Kuyt -26,
Martijn Meerdink -30, Ruud van Nistelrooy -30,
Robin van Persie -23, Arjen Robben -22,
Jan Vennegoor of Hesselink -28
All those averages work out to a squad average age of just over 28. I’m surprised actually. I thought it would have been lower. This gives me even more confidence, particularly in defense. By the time Euro 2008 rolls around new keepers will be needed along with replacements for Cocu, Davids and van Nistelrooy (probably).
